Well, when I tried to emerge the xfree 4.2.0-r9 package (serveral times), at work's computer, I found that compilation stops always in directory /var/tmp/portage/xfree-4.2.0-r9/work/xc/lib/Xft/ when trying to execute the command bison -y -d xftgram.y.
I get a "Violación de segmento" ( = "segmentation fault" ) message. I've tried in my home's computer and get the same result.
This sounds strange to me as I have installed this xfree version from scratch at home and I didn't get any problems.
I have installed on both computers the 1.34-r1 version of bison. Also I noticed that versions 1.30 and 1.32 are masked in portage
Quote: |
# this new bison has problems and breaks nearly anything that uses it.
=sys-devel/bison-1.30
=sys-devel/bison-1.32
|
...so I downgrade to bison-1.28-r3 with
Code: |
emerge unmerge =bison-1.34-r1
emerge =sys-devel/bison-1.28-r3
|
Now all compile problems are gone! (Now I remember that my home's computer was a 1.0rc6 Gentoo and probably when I emerged the xfree bison was 1.28, not sure)
(On both computers I've manually masked the 1.34 and 1.34-r1 releases as It seems that doesn't work -- at least for me)
